Output 7f83302243efd056562581a819577c8c378d099b68b07c9e1913e201c7d9aac3:2

value
7610742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b6d786ebe2657fb52a1cd3a131c4e7f2e5657ca OP_EQUAL
address
3A2SZ94cyyzuVy42N9HrRt7wtTeSWezh6i
transaction
7f83302243efd056562581a819577c8c378d099b68b07c9e1913e201c7d9aac3
confirmations
43537
spent
true